Skip to main content
Read books more efficiently - Booqs.com

Login

Main menu

  • Home
  • Quotes
  • Books

About Booqs

Booqs will try to innovate the way we read and choose which knowledge to absorb. Share the most important parts of books to create a community driven knowledge aggregation.
Debugging is twice as hard as writing a program in the first place. So if you're as clever as you can be when you write it, how will you ever debug it?
Brian W. Kernighan
A complex system that works is invariably found to have evolved from a simple system that worked. The inverse proposition also appears to be true: A complex system designed from scratch never works and cannot be made to work. You have to start over, beginning with a working simple system.
John Gall
Douglas Crockford: Code reading requires a lot of trust on the part of the team members so there have to be clear rules as to what's in bounds and what's not. If you had a dysfunctional team, you don't want to be doing this, because they'll tear themselves apart.
Peter Seibel
The manager's function is not to make people work, but to make it possible for people to work.
Tom DeMarco
The bearing of a child takes nine months, no matter how many women are assigned.
Frederick P. Brooks
Adding manpower to a late software project makes it later.
Frederick P. Brooks
The source code is often the only accurate description of the software. On many projects, the only documentation available to programmers is the code itself. Requirements specifications and design documents can go out of date, but the source code is always up to date.
Steve McConnell
Testing by itself does not improve software quality. Test results are an indicator of quality, but in and of themselves, they don't improve it. Trying to improve software quality by increasing the amount of testing is like trying to lose weight by weighing yourself more often.
Steve McConnell

Contact